Genoa – For the third day at Orientazioni the visitors amounted to 45,000 physical and remote, the positive trend of the previous days is therefore confirmed. Great interest was registered among the online presences with connections from Puglia, Campania and Sicily, among others, and contacts recorded from Bolzano to Modica. Physical attendance at the Show reached a maximum of 5,000, as required by the regulations, with the virtual ones generated by clicks on the streaming links, which testified to the success of the event returned in attendance, is reported in a press release.
The meeting between General Figliuolo and the students sold out. The commissioner for the Covid emergency – 19 exalted the concept of React and praised the boys and girls for their commitment and their adherence to the vaccination campaign, as well as that of grandparents, enhancing the intergenerational pact to contain the pandemic. “Another very important day – commented the regional councilor for education Ilaria Cavo – which recorded a confirmation of the general attendance and flows in the individual conferences. In particular, the meeting with General Figliuolo was sold out, recognizing to young people the great ability to be responsible in this pandemic period. But the numbers presented by the Digital School project are a great sign because they demonstrate the great reactivity of the school with the pandemic: the teachers who join have more than doubled this year and they exceed 5 thousand “.
Blitz of a dozen “no Green pass” students in Orientations
In the evening, a dozen “no Green pass” students broke into the agora dedicated to the University to protest against the obligation of the green certificate to participate in the show and to attend lectures in the university. The episode took place shortly after 20.30, less than half an hour after the end of the event.
According to the reconstruction of the organizers, the young protesters may have entered through a fire door opened by someone inside the Cotton Warehouses. After unrolling the banner “Genoese students against the Green pass”, the demonstrators made a brief speech on the megaphone.
Interrupted by the security, they responded with some choruses, finished the speech and then disappeared without being recognized. The protest, we read in the well-known Telegram chat “Libera Piazza Genova” which gathers the opponents of the Green pass in the Ligurian capital and which has also published two videos of the blitz, is a “response to the violence of those who imposed the Green pass to access the Salone Orientazioni and related events. Hearing about the future and the right to study by those who daily humiliate and attack thousands of students is disgusting and cannot be accepted. A right is either everyone’s or it’s a privilege “.
